#222614 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#222614 is composed of 13.3% red, 14.9%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 47.4% yellow and 85.1% black. It has a hue angle of 73.3 degrees, a saturation of 31% and a lightness of 11.4%. #222614 color hex could be obtained by blending #444c28 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

#222614 color description : Very dark (mostly black) yellow [Olive tone].

#222614 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#222614 has RGB values of R:34, G:38, B:20 and CMYK values of C:0.11, M:0, Y:0.47, K:0.85. Its decimal value is 2237972.

Shades and Tints of #222614

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0c06 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#222614

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#1d1d1d is the less saturated color, while #2c3802 is the most saturated one.
